How to Replace the Steering Damper on a Jeep Cherokee
- 1). Pop the hood of your vehicle and locate the steering damper. It looks similar to a shock absorber and runs parallel to the axle of your Cherokee.
- 2). Remove the two mounting bolts with a ratchet and a 15 mm socket. The nut on the opposite side will require a 19 mm wrench.
- 3). Remove the damper from the brackets.
- 4). Position the new steering damper into the brackets.
- 5). Reinstall the stock bolts and nuts. Tighten them with a ratchet, socket and wrench.
